Engine becomes an Employee-Owned Trust


After more than 25 years of helping organisations reimagine their customer experience, we’ve reimagined something of our own: how we run our business. 

Engine is now officially an Employee-Owned Trust (EoT), which means every person who works at Engine now has a stake in the company’s future. 

It’s a big moment, and one we’re proud of. As a company that puts people at the heart of everything we do, becoming an EoT reflects our belief in a unified and collaborative approach, while building a team of people who genuinely care. And we couldn’t be more excited.  

CEO Lisa Skinner said: “We’ve always helped our clients reimagine the way they deliver their customer experience – so it felt only right to reimagine the way we run our own business. 

“Moving to an Employee-Owned Trust is a natural step for us. It reflects the ‘together’ approach that’s always been at the heart of how we work – with each other and with our clients. It’s about shared purpose, long-term commitment, and making sure the business stays true to the values we’ve built it on, together.”
